Grauman's Chinese Theater is a worldwide-famous movie theater located at 6925 Hollywood Boulevard in Hollywood. The Chinese Theater was commissioned following the success of the nearby Grauman's Egyptian Theatre which opened in 1922. Built over 18 months beginning in January 1926 by a partnership headed by Sid Grauman, the theater opened May 18, 1927 with the premiere of Cecil B. DeMille's The King of Kings.
